It can't be denied that Luke Skywalker is still an influential figure in the Star Wars universe and his appearances in post-Skywalker Saga projects like The Mandalorian and The Book of Boba Fett only prove that the character remains an integral part of the beloved franchise.

Considering the MandoVerse is beginning to expand, it would only make sense for more Luke Skywalker-centric stories to be explored. There were even rumors claiming that Lucasfilm is planning to do a standalone show for the Jedi Master which would chronicle his adventures during the New Republic Era.

However, it doesn't look like Mark Hamill is down to helping recreate the character in a future project despite contributing to the MandoVerse on two separate occasions. Speaking with Esquire, the 71-year-old icon expressed his desire to step away from the character and allow a younger actor to take on the role.

Surprisingly enough, Star Wars diehards echo Hamill's sentiments and following his admission, the movement to convince Lucasfilm to recast Luke Skywalker has been reinforced.

As impressive as Lucasfilm's facial capture technology has been, I think we can all agree that it has overstayed its welcome. And frankly speaking, it should only be utilized to bring deceased actors for cameos similar to what they did with Peter Cushing in Rogue One and Carrie Fisher in The Last Jedi and The Rise of Skywalker.

Now, if Lucasfilm actually decides to do more stories centered on a young Luke, I believe it's time they considered recasting the character, especially now that Hamill has given the idea his blessing.
